LJ54 EBX is a 2004 Bentley Continental in Blue with a 6,005c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 20 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 80%.
Across all 2004 Bentley Continental models, the average MOT pass rate is 88.7% with a typical mileage of 48,492 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Bentley Continental fails its MOT is tyre has a cut in excess of the requirements deep enough to reach the ply or cords, accounting for 937 recorded failures. If you're considering buying LJ54 EBX,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Bentley Continental typically stays on UK roads for around 29 years. At 22 years old, this Bentley Continental is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
